[0022] like figure 1 As shown, the input of the circuit of the present invention is a plurality of communication channels, and the output is a single communication channel. Each communication channel includes a data channel (the input end is Data_i, the output end is Data) and the corresponding handshake control line (the input end is ACKi, the output end is ACK), and each data channel contains a multi-bit double-rail coded data bits. The circuit mainly includes three modules: an arbitration circuit (in the dotted line box), a handshake control module and an output controller.
